FEDERAL RESERVE BOARD WASHINGTON ADDRESS OFFICIAL CORRESPONDENCE TO THE FEDERAL RESERVE BOARD X-6346 July 24, 1929. SUBJECT: Expense, Main Line, Leased Wire System, June, 1929. Dear Sir: Enclosed herewith you will find two mimeograph statements, X-6346-a and X-6346-b, covering in detail operations of the main line, Leased Wire System, during the month of June, 1929. Please credit the amount payable by your bank in the general account, Treasurer, U. S., on your books, and issue C/D Form 1, National Banks, for account of "Salaries and Expenses, Federal Reserve Board, Special Fund", Leased Wire System, sending duplicate C/D to the Federal Reserve Board. Very truly yours, Fiscal Agent. Enclosures. TO GOVERNORS OF ALL F. R. BANKS EXCEPT CHICAGO.
